Punta Gorda weather in December

In December, Punta Gorda sees average daytime highs of 27°C and overnight lows near 22°C, with 145 mm of rain across 20.3 wet days and about 11.1 hours of daylight. It is the 11th-warmest and 9th-wettest month of the year here.

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 27°C through the month.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 35% of the time in December, and the air most often feels oppressive.

Daylight stretches from about 11 h 06 min at the start of December to 11 h 06 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, December is Punta Gorda's 5th-clearest and 10th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Punta Gorda's year-round climate.

Temperature in December

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 27°C through the month.

A typical December day in Punta Gorda reaches about 27°C in the afternoon and slips back to 22°C overnight — a 4°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 24°C and 29°C. Set against its neighbours, December runs about 1°C cooler than November and on par with January.

Chance of precipitation in December

Any precipitation

Punta Gorda gets around 145 mm of rain over 20.3 wet days in December. The line is the day-by-day chance of measurable precipitation.

Day to day, the chance of measurable rain averages around 66% and peaks near 70% on the wettest days. The odds ease toward the end of the month.

Hazard calendar for Punta Gorda

In seasonPeak

None of Punta Gorda's seasonal hazards are active in December. The full-year calendar below shows when the rainy season, cyclone risk and dust haze do peak.

Punta Gorda sits in the Atlantic hurricane belt; the season peaks August–October.

Punta Gorda's rainy season runs May–November, when most of the year's rain falls.

Location & terrain

Where is Punta Gorda?

Punta Gorda sits at 16.1°N, 88.8°W, 0 m above sea level, in Belize. The nearest listed city is Lívingston, 31 km away.

Topography around Punta Gorda

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Punta Gorda.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Punta Gorda has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 158 m around an average of 8 m above sea level; within 16 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 315 m; within 80 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,263 m.

The land around Punta Gorda is covered by trees (46%) and water (44%) within 3 km, water (51%) and trees (44%) within 16 km, and trees (54%) and water (29%) within 80 km.
